It all happened on the night of May 19. Traffic police officers stopped a car with Stavropol residents in the village of Tbilisskaya for violating traffic rules.
“At that time, when the police officers were checking the driver’s documents, three passengers, including a woman, got out of the car and, to prevent the driver from assuming administrative responsibility, used violence against the police officer, inflicting multiple punches and kicks on his head and trunk,” said the press service of the investigation department.
A criminal case was opened under the article on the use of violence dangerous to life and health against a government official. According to him, violators face up to 10 years in prison.
The investigation was brought under control by the head of the Investigative Directorate of the Investigative Committee of the Russian Federation for the Krasnodar Territory, Andrey Maslov.
